an English Congregational minister, was born at-Kendal, March 25, 1817. He was a converted in his youth, received his, ministerial training at Highbury College, and began his ministry in 1842, at Totteridge, Herts. After twelve years of earnest and happy labor there, during which he had made himself thoroughly acquainted with the standard philosophical works of the day, and become well versed in Hebrew, Greek, and Latin, he filled the pulpit of Masborough, .Yorkshire, a short time, and then was invited to the theological professorship of Western College, at Plymouth, where he died, Dec. 12,1875. See (Lond.) Cong. Year-book, 1877, p. 350.
